Food is neither good nor bad.

Unless it’s poisoned or you’re allergic to it…

It all comes down to timings, frequency, portions and context.

I say this almost every week to my athletes and clients.

Eating coco pops and Rice Bubbles for breakfast in every day life is a recipe for feeling hungry and snacking later - not ideal if your goal is weight loss or management.

BUT for race days they can be perfect to eat on a carb loading day or just before a big race as they sit light in the stomach and don’t make you feel full.

Meaning you can eat more and fuel better racing performance.

The food isn’t good or bad - it’s just more ideal in one scenario than the other.

Understanding what you’re eating, when and why is key to make sustainable changes that support your training.

If you can’t stick with a diet long term..

It’s setting you up to fail.

Stop chasing perfection or waiting for the perfect moment to start.

There is no such thing as a perfect diet or a perfect moment.

The best diet for you is the one you can stick with when life gets chaotic.

The best moment to make a change is now.

Start where you are and rather than trying to change everything at once, focus on one or two things you can improve just a little bit and build upon.

Over time those little changes compound and result in bigger overall outcome.

Progress over perfection.
